  • Paucity Meanings

    noun a smallness of quantity or number; scarcity; dearth

    Fields related to paucity

    Environmental Science

    In environmental science, 'paucity' can be used to discuss a scarcity of natural resources or a lack of biodiversity in a particular ecosystem.

    Academic Writing

    In academic writing, the word 'paucity' is often used to describe a lack or shortage of something, such as a paucity of research on a particular topic.

    Statistics

    In statistics, 'paucity' may be used to describe a small sample size or a lack of data available for analysis.

    Economics

    In economics, 'paucity' can refer to a scarcity or insufficiency of resources, leading to economic challenges.
